While field inspection is not part of OSHA's NRTL program, OSHA rules allow another government (federal, state, local) organization to determine compliance with the NEC. See: https://www.osha.gov/laws-regs/regulations/standardnumber/1910/1910.399 I would guess that such a government organization (not the manufacturer) would hire a NRTL to do a field inspection. Just a comment/clarification. The field inspection/label program is not part of OSHA's NRTL program despite some NRTL's that conducted this service. I know it can seem confusing but there are also some non-NRTL's that conduct these field evaluations, all of which are under state jurisdiction. Some may think they are abiding by OSHA rules with obtaining a field evaluation by an NRTL. That is not the case.
